Is the Accelerator Pedal Not Used in Subject Two?

Subject Two examination does not require the use of the accelerator pedal. Subject Two is a closed-course driving test where the entire test can be completed in first gear without needing to press the accelerator. During the Subject Two test, examinees have limited driving skills and lack adaptability in operating within the restricted course. Excessive speed can easily lead to crossing lines or even collisions. To facilitate novice drivers in controlling the vehicle speed, the test vehicle's idle speed is set relatively higher. Engaging first gear or reverse gear without applying throttle is sufficient to complete all test items. In many places, to prevent examinees from mistakenly pressing the accelerator, the accelerator pedal is temporarily sealed or even removed. What are the reasons for the illumination of the car's stability control system light?

The reasons for the illumination of the car's stability control system light are: 1. Misoperation by the owner; 2. Malfunction of the electronic stability control system; 3. Damage to the car's wheel speed sensor. The stability control system includes: 1. Electronic brake force distribution system; 2. Anti-lock braking system; 3. Traction control system; 4. Vehicle dynamic control system. The working principle of the stability control system is: judging the driving state based on sensor signals and performing well-controlled calculations through the control unit, which individually controls each wheel when rotation, understeer, or oversteer occurs to improve vehicle stability.

Does Replacing Engine Mounts Require a Break-In Period?

Replacing engine mounts does require a break-in period. The function and location of engine mounts are as follows: Function of Engine Mounts: When the engine is running, it generates certain vibrations. Engine mounts contain rubber components that help eliminate resonance produced during engine operation. Some mounts also feature hydraulic pressure reduction functions, all aimed at the same goal—ensuring smoother and more stable engine operation, thereby providing a more comfortable driving experience for the occupants. Location of Engine Mounts: There is one engine mount on each side of the engine, and an additional mount at the transmission bracket.

What are the methods to determine when tires need replacement?

Methods to determine when tires need replacement are: 1. Check for visible damage on the tire surface; 2. Assess the degree of tire wear; 3. Pay attention to the production date. The functions of tires are: 1. Transmit driving force, braking force, and steering force to achieve vehicle control; 2. Support vehicle load; 3. Reduce and absorb vibrations and impacts during driving, preventing severe vibrations from damaging vehicle components. Tire maintenance methods include: 1. Regularly remove stones stuck in tire treads; 2. Minimize exposure to direct sunlight; 3. Promptly check tire pressure; 4. Pay attention to suspension maintenance; 5. Regularly inspect front wheel alignment; 6. Be mindful of driving habits.
